Systematic elaboration of online energy management laws for hybrid vehicles

Résumé

In this paper, we describe a systematic methodology to elaborate hybrid vehicle energy management laws. "Systematic" means that this conception is done with minimal tuning, whatever the hybrid vehicle architecture and sizing are. A radial basis function type neural network is used to learn from the offline energy management laws given by an optimization tool named KOALA. Then the trained neural network can be used to control the hybrid vehicle online. The results are satisfactory as regards hybrid vehicle fuel consumption. This study has been implemented on a high dynamic test bench in hardware in the loop, and is still in progress.
